The Japanese coach, Hajime Moriyasu, could be said to be clever at seeing opportunities. He and the Japanese Football Federation (JFA) proposed a change to the kick-off schedule to the AFC to play against the Indonesian National Team. By mutual agreement with the Indonesian Football Federation (PSSI), changes to the kick-off schedule were made. The schedule which was originally held on Thursday (14/11) was shifted one day to Friday (15/11). The Indonesia vs Japan national team match at the Gelora Bung Karno Stadium will be the last qualifying match for the 2026 World Cup from the Asian zone on matchday 5. The reason Hajime Moriyasu proposed changing the schedule was to create comfort for his team. Many Japanese players work abroad (Europe) and travel further afield so that when they return to the national team, they only have a short time to adapt. Moriyasu wanted more than that. In terms of rest time, the Japanese national team has longer time. In September and October, for example, the Japanese national team immediately flies to the next venue after playing the first match. This will be different from now against the Indonesian National Team, Takumi Minamino and colleagues can return to the hotel first to rest. Only the next night after the match left for Xiamen, China. “We created better conditions,” explained Tomiyasu at the press conference announcing the list of Japanese players today, Tuesday (7/11/2024) as quoted by Nikkan Sports. “After thinking about how we would travel, we decided to make a different trip than before, by resting and traveling at night instead of traveling in the morning. The players were ready (with that plan),” he continued. The implication of changing the kick-off time is to create an interesting match climate. The player’s prime condition will enable the player to perform optimally in the match. Therefore, the initial rest break before the match when overseas European players arrive has more time to rest and adapt. The issue of overseas players in Europe does not only concern Japanese players, but also the Indonesian national team. “Due to difficulties in scheduling, it was difficult to organize everything,” said the Director of the Japanese National Team, Masakuni Yamamoto. “We were able to make this arrangement because we have a good relationship with the Indonesian association,” he added. Hajime Moriyasu is grateful that the change in kick-off time for the Indonesia vs Japan National Team can be realized. “We are very grateful for the additional day,” he said. “The reason is, we have to familiarize ourselves first with local conditions.” “Even if we go to Indonesia, the difference in temperature and climate is quite big. From a tactical perspective, we can train once again and hold another meeting which will allow us to share concepts and ways of dueling in preparation for the match.” “I want to use it effectively,” he concluded.
